Top Countries and States, as of January 2015

This page shows one of the many rankings computed with RePEc data. They are based on data about authors who have registered with the RePEc Author Service, institutions listed on EDIRC, bibliographic data collected by RePEc, citation analysis performed by CitEc and popularity data compiled by LogEc. Number of Citations, Weighted by Number of Authors and Recursive Impact Factors, Discounted by Citation Age

  • Only authors registered with the RePEc Author Service are considered.
  • Only works listed on RePEc and claimed as theirs by registered authors are counted.
  • Citations are determined from references of listed works. Both the cited and citing works have to be listed in RePEc. See CitEc for details on the citation extraction.
  • Each citation is weighted by its recursive discounted impact factor.
  • Different versions of the same work published in different series or journals are counted only once, the version with the highest impact factor being considered.
  • The score of each work is divided by the number of authors.
  • Self-Citations are excluded.
  • Each citation is discounted by its age in years (1/age).
  • Authors with multiple affiliations are attributed to each according to the weights they have set to each in their profile, or by default according to a formula described here.
  • Only institutions listed in EDIRC are counted.
  • Institutions are then attributed to the country or state of their location.

The data presented here is experimental. It is based on a limited sample of the research output in Economics and Finance. Only material catalogued in RePEc is considered. For any citation based criterion, only works that could be parsed by the CitEc project are considered. For any ranking of people, only those registered with the RePEc Author Service can be taken into account. And for rankings of institutions, only those listed in EDIRC and claimed as affiliation by the respective, registered authors can be measured. Thus, this list is by no means based on a complete sample.
